Rain thudded against the windows, and M-21 huffed, keeping an ear turned towards it. Tao didn’t seem bothered by it – in fact, he was alternating between his toys and watching the rain drip past the windows.
It was much better inside when it rained. Even though M-21's coat was thicker now so he wouldn’t feel it, it was just...nice to be dry when-
He flinched at the light that lit up the sky, a low growl following it a few seconds later. It wasn't a fight. He knew that. He couldn’t feel any auras nearby, no killing intent. He still tensed when more lightning flashed, looking where to dodge.
"Mrow?"
And Tao had noticed, coming up to him and pressing his body against M-21's leg. "Mrow."
M-21 exhaled, licking Tao's head, making his ears twitch. He could do this. He was fi-
He hunched over at the next lightning flash, and headed for the corner furthest away from the garden doors. He would have gone to his bed, but he would be trapped there if... Just in case something did attack them, it would be better if he could move easier.
Tao followed him, and when M-21 curled up in the corner, Tao pushed up against him, purring as hard as he could. At least one of them enjoyed the storm.
M-21 didn’t look up when he heard the living room door open, too focused on listening for when the next lightning strike would happen.
"M-21?"
Oh, it was Frankenstein. M-21 tried to wag his tail in greeting, but it was tucked away and stiff.
"What's wr-"
Another flash and M-21 flinched again, not able to stop his whine clawing out his throat. He was a guard; he shouldn’t be scared. He would be punished for showing weakness.
"Ah, I hadn't thought..."
M-21 curled up tighter when he saw Frankenstein's slippered feet near him, but he snapped his head up when he felt Frankenstein pet his head, seeing Frankenstein's smiling face.
"Let's go downstairs, shall we?"
To be punished? But...Frankenstein usually wanted something if he asked M-21 to go into the lab. And Frankenstein didn’t smile like that when he was angry either.
Slowly, M-21 got to his feet, and Frankenstein continued smiling at him. It would be all right? M-21 trot – he dashed out at the next lightning flash, not wanting to wait for the thunder to follow.
He exhaled when Frankenstein closed the door behind him, shutting off most of the sound. There were other windows in the corridor, but the sound didn’t carry as well through them. Tao followed them, and M-21 concentrated on not kicking him as Tao insisted on trying to twine between his limbs.
Down to the lab, and for once, each step further into the lab made M-21 relax as he was surrounded by the low hum of machines rather than the drumming rain.
"Not there, M-21," Frankenstein said, making him pause. M-21 looked between the main lab doors and to Frankenstein, who was standing at a different corridor. They weren't going to the main lab? Then where...?
M-21 followed, studying the corridor as they walked. He hadn’t been there before, so he didn't know what Frankenstein wanted him to do here.
"Here we are," Frankenstein said, opening one of the doors.
M-21 poked his head in and...
It was an empty room. White tiles covered the floor, walls, and ceiling, and that was it. The room was about the size of Frankenstein's office, but it looked so much bigger because there was nothing else taking up space.
Tao dashed in, running and exploring at the same time.
M-21 looked up at Frankenstein, tilting his head. What was this?
"This should be quiet enough for you," Frankenstein said, walking in, and M-21 followed him. Quiet enough for what?
When Frankenstein sat down, leaning against a wall, he patted the floor next to him, a gesture M-21 knew meant he was sit next to him. M-21 did as he was told, and he closed his eyes when Frankenstein started scratching his chest, leaning into the touch.
"Is this better?"
Better? He couldn't hear the rain here and...
Oh.
Was that why Frankenstein had brought him here?
But. M-21 opened his eyes, looking Frankenstein over. Didn’t he have work to do?
Frankenstein chuckled, continuing to scratch M-21. "I do need breaks as well. The storm shouldn't be around for too long, and I guess I should furnish this room so there's more interesting things inside it. We could make them right now in fact, while we wait for the storm to abate. Do you want to do that?"
While M-21 considered the question, Tao climbed up onto Frankenstein's lap, purring.
Hmm. M-21 shook his head, and pressed his forehead against Frankenstein's shoulder. He didn't want to go anywhere else right now...
"All right," Frankenstein murmured. "We'll think about that later."
Yes. When there wasn't a storm raging overhead.
